2019 – Annual Meeting of the Membership CFO – Jennifer Cortes • Serving: Jan 2019 to Dec 2019 • Overall Oversight and Responsibility for the P&L • Track and Monitor Expenses • Check and Balance for all Transactions • Mitigate Financial Risk Ø Current Initiative: Convert from debit cards to credit cards on Chapter bank accounts Ø The Fair Credit Billing Act (FCBA) caps the credit card liability at $50 Ø Debit card fraud protection covered by Electronic Funds Transfer Act (EFTA), and protection varies from $50 up to entire amount withdrawn from account © 2019 Project Management Institute - Wine Country Chapter 27

2019 – Annual Meeting of the Membership Ethics PMI members have determined that honesty, responsibility, respect and fairness are the values that drive ethical conduct for the project management profession. PMI’s Code of Ethics and Professional Conduct applies those values to the real-life practice of project management, where the best outcome is the most ethical one. All PMI members, volunteers, certification holders and certification applicants must comply with the Code. © 2019 Project Management Institute - Wine Country Chapter 36
